Energy Optimizing and Cooler Interiors

Texas summers can be brutally hot, causing your air conditioner to work overtime and driving up your energy bills. Residential window tint acts as a powerful barrier that blocks a large percentage of solar heat before it reaches your windows. By reducing the amount of heat entering your home, the film helps maintain a cooler, more comfortable indoor temperature year-round. This means less strain on your HVAC system, optimized energy costs, and a more enjoyable living space no matter how high the mercury rises outside.

UV Protection for Your Family and Furnishings

The sun’s ultraviolet rays are harmful in more ways than 1. They can cause skin damage and increase the risk of health issues for your family while also fading and degrading your furniture, flooring, curtains, and artwork. Our high-quality window films block up to 99% of these damaging UV rays, helping to protect your loved ones and preserve the beauty of your home’s interior. This long-lasting protection ensures your rooms stay vibrant and your family stays safer from harmful sun exposure.

Enhanced Privacy and Glare Reduction

Living in Texas means enjoying plenty of sunshine, but too much sunlight can create uncomfortable glare on screens and reduce your privacy. Window tinting gives you the best of both worlds by cutting down on harsh glare from the sun while limiting the view into your home from outside. This allows natural light to fill your rooms without sacrificing comfort or privacy. Whether you’re watching TV, working from home, or relaxing with family, tinted windows create a more peaceful and private environment that’s perfect for everyday living.

  • 1. What types of window tint films do you offer for homes?

    We offer several types of window tint films designed to meet different needs and budgets. These include solar films that reduce heat and block harmful UV rays, decorative films that add privacy and style, and reflective films that improve privacy while cutting glare. We also provide clear ceramic films that protect your home without changing the appearance of your windows. Our team will help you choose the best option based on your goals and the unique features of your home.

  • 2. How does window tinting affect the temperature inside my home?

    Window tinting helps keep your home cooler by blocking a significant amount of the sun’s heat before it passes through your windows. This reduces hot spots and keeps indoor temperatures more consistent, making your living spaces more comfortable even on the hottest Texas days.

  • 3. Will window tinting reduce natural light inside my home?

    Most modern window films are designed to balance heat and UV protection while allowing plenty of natural light to enter your home. Depending on the film you choose, you can enjoy cooler, more comfortable rooms without a noticeable darkening effect. Our experts will guide you to a film that meets your comfort needs while preserving the brightness and openness of your living spaces.

  • 4. How long does residential window tint last?

    When installed by professionals using high-quality films, residential window tint can last for 10 years or more without fading, bubbling, or peeling. The films we use are made to withstand sun exposure, heat, and daily wear. Proper care and gentle cleaning will help maintain the film’s appearance and performance throughout its lifespan.

  • 5. Is window tinting difficult to maintain or clean?

    Window tinting is very easy to maintain. Simply clean your windows with a mild soap and water solution and a soft cloth or sponge. Avoid using abrasive cleaners, ammonia-based products, or harsh chemicals, as these can damage the film. With simple care, your tinted windows will stay looking great and performing well for years to come.
